“Pete & Brenda in the Morning” ® KFIS 104.1 the FISH, Portland, OR
Accomplishments Top 10 Morning Show ranking with target demo (Women 25-54). Over 100 Public Service appearances yearly at area schools, churches, and community service organizations.
Highlights Highest ranking - #4 Women 25-54 Mornings 6-10am. Developed “Pete & Brenda Third Thursday Book Club” ™ with Barnes & Noble which accelerated listener and community relations and significantly increased station marketing and promotion. The “Pete & Brenda Third Thursday Book Club” ™ also resulted in thousands of dollars of additional station revenue from Disney. Developed “Pete & Brenda Luncheon and Shoe Auction” in partnership with DSW which raised thousands of dollars for breast cancer research. Created popular “Healthy Wednesday” with features that included a 90-second nutrition segment. This partnership with Albertson’s Food Stores earned significant additional station revenue.
Strengths A morning show that generated laughter and lots of entertaining banter. Exceptional community service involvement and development of listener and client relationships. Wrote, developed and produced all morning show production including opens, testimonials, phone-calls, interviews and specialty segments. Exceptional work ethics, show prep skills, seamless production, and focused delivery.
 
   
“Pete & Brenda in the Morning” WYYY-FM/Y94, Syracuse, NY
Accomplishments #1 Rated AC Morning Show. Over 200 appearances per year.
Highlights Ranked Top 3 in Women 25-54. Spokespersons for Make-a-Wish and Rescue Mission. Successful Endorsement campaigns for Campbell’s Soup, Swiffer, and Proctor and Gamble, among others. Proctor and Gamble returned for a record 5 endorsement campaigns earning a significant amount of additional revenue for the station.
Strengths A morning show that stepped in successfully for a beloved 20-year morning show veteran. Lively and topical banter, a one-of-a-kind chemistry and on-air rapport that engaged listeners and was as much a source of good information as it was entertainment. Exceptional community service presence in the community.
 
   
Brenda – Program Director & Midday Host, WZUN/Sunny 102, Syracuse, NY
Accomplishments Established position as Central New York’s “One & Only Soft Rock Station.” Improved overall station Women numbers and moved into Top 10, Women 25-54 and ranked 7th Women 35-64. Strengthened station community service involvement.
Highlights Improved At-Work/Midday to #5 ranking Women 35-64 and increased 25-54 Women ranking from 3.0 to 4.4 and moved from 10th to 8th position. Developed major television ad campaign for Sunny 102 with Juli Boeheim (Wife of Syracuse Men’s Head Basketball Coach, Jim Boeheim). Helped to recruit major advertisers away from major competitor with creative marketing and on-air programming/promotion/sales campaigns without sacrificing on-air sound. Was part of a team (Programming/Promotions/Sales) that created groundbreaking models to enhance programming and increase revenue. Created a successful and entertaining fundraiser for Casey’s Place, a first of it’s kind (in the country) respite home for severely medically, physically, mentally, and emotionally challenged children, teens, and young adults.
Strengths Station imaging and positioning, music, talent & program development, community service, events planning and client relationships.
